Released on JSP Records in 2009, this compilation features 24 tracks that showcase Coward's versatility as a composer, lyricist, and performer.
From the nostalgic charm of "I'm Old Fashioned" to the poignant reflections of "This Is A Changing World," each song is a testament to Coward's enduring appeal. The album includes beloved standards like "You'd Be So Nice To Come Home To" and "Sigh No More," as well as lesser-known gems that highlight his lyrical genius. The Noël Coward Medley is a particular highlight, weaving together some of his most iconic songs into a seamless and enchanting musical journey.
